What is a full stack data engineer?
Career: Full Stack Data Engineer
A Full Stack Data Engineer is a professional who designs, builds, and maintains the entire data pipeline, from data collection and storage to processing and visualization. They work with both the backend infrastructure (such as databases, data warehouses, and ETL processes) and frontend tools (like dashboards or reporting systems) to ensure data is accessible and usable for analytics. Full Stack Data Engineers possess skills in programming, database management, data modeling, cloud platforms, and often data visualization, allowing them to manage every stage of data flow within an organization.
